Output 629868a511f8f3169ba0641b3198bb3095f00a3ba17f73c61dee2df514da1969:0

value
23749531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7afd51c95604be67da084e1f75b067b6aca75eab OP_EQUAL
address
3CuKptkGYmxPppYRF6chRMdAcFWgJfhp1H
transaction
629868a511f8f3169ba0641b3198bb3095f00a3ba17f73c61dee2df514da1969
confirmations
525152
spent
true